2. A square C18 flint dovecote with red brick dressings. There are 4 round window openings, now blocked, the one above the doorway has, a round stone panel with a well carved heraldic lion of much earlier date, possibly from the old Hall of the Mosleys. Roof slate pyramid, with a wood cupola (blocked).

The Church of St Peter, The Stables, formerly to Ousden Hall and dovecote form a group.
